    Hi, Has anyone heard of issues with burning .ISO files with the A100. My A100 will burn audio CDs (iTunes), and will burn data files in Nero 6, but will not burn .ISO based images with Nero 6 or DVD Decrypter. This is a recent issue (last 5 weeks) and has worked before that. I've tried using another Admin account and have reinstalled the OS but nothing seems to help. Any suggestions?

    I tried the burnCDCC in two different user accounts & the issues remains. I get a device error when initiating the burn. Burning CDs & reading DVDs still works normally. The optical drive is a Mat****a DVD -RAM UJ-841S Superdrive. I've also uninstalled the optical drive from the device manager & restarted, but issue remains. Any other suggestions before a hardware repair?
